Vocational Nursing Program Director
$100,000–$140,000 year
On-site · Rancho Mirage, California, United States
Job Summary
Director of Vocational Nursing Program overseeing academic quality and student experience, including retention initiatives, managing faculty and clinical/externship sites, providing faculty training, conducting classroom observations, program review, assessing and reporting on student learning outcomes, assuring accreditation compliance, and coordinating program operations with potential teaching duties. Requires overseeing equipment inventory, credentialing and licensure documentation for faculty, and participating in admissions and employment services; must meet standards for accreditation and maintain curriculum and course objectives with regular program leadership and committee involvement.
Required Qualifications
- Baccalaureate Degree from an accredited school
- Current California active RN license
- Minimum of 3 years’ experience as a registered nurse; one year shall be in teaching or clinical supervision (or combination) in a state approved RN or VN/PN program within the last 5 years OR minimum of 3 years’ experience in nursing administration or nursing education within the last 5 years
- Degrees from institutions accredited by U.S. accrediting agencies; degrees from non-U.S. institutions recognized only if equivalence established
